The 316 grade alloy, renowned for its enhanced molybdenum content, provides exceptional resistance to pitting and crevice corrosion, especially in chloride-rich environments. This makes it an ideal substrate for hand tools exposed to marine, chemical, or food processing conditions. Its high tensile strength and formability allow for precise shaping and long-term performance.

| Tensile Strength | 75,000 psi (515 MPa) |
| Yield Strength | 30,000 psi (205 MPa) |
| Elongation in 2 in. | 40% min |
| Hardness | Rockwell B95 max |
| Carbon (C) | 0.08% max |
| Chromium (Cr) | 16.0 - 18.0% |
| Nickel (Ni) | 10.0 - 14.0% |
| Molybdenum (Mo) | 2.0 - 3.0% |

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ard carbon steel cutting tools which can lead to contamination and reduced corrosion resistance. | Utilize dedicated stainless steel cutting tools or ensure thorough cleaning of shared tools before use. |
| Improper welding techniques that can compromise the material's corrosion resistance. | Employ TIG or MIG welding with appropriate filler materials and shielding gases designed for 316 stainless steel, and ensure post-weld cleaning. |
